MOSTAR, Jan 24 (Hina) - Following separate meetings between
Mostar's EU Administrator, Hans Koschnik, and Croat and Moslem
representatives on Tuesday, the Administration felt it unlikely
that the two sides would find a solution for Mostar by mutual
agreement, spokesman for the EU Administration, Dragan Gasic, told
Hina on Wednesday.
The meeting discussed municipality boundaries and the
establishment of a central zone.
Administrator Koschnik would therefore be called upon to
pronounce on the issue, Gasic said.
However, Koschnik needed "some more time to collect further
information," according to Gasic.
He announced that the decision would be made known after
Koschnik's return from a meeting with EU Foreign Ministers, which
is to take place in Brussels next Monday.
